Medicaid, for example, typically pays dentists on a fee-for-service basis, meaning you are reimbursed for each covered service provided to a patient. The rates for each service are predetermined by the state and can vary widely. It's important to familiarize yourself with the fee schedule and ensure you are billing accurately to maximize your reimbursement.

In addition to fee-for-service reimbursement, some states may offer capitation payments or other alternative payment models. Capitation payments involve receiving a set monthly or annual fee per patient enrolled in the state insurance program, regardless of the services provided. While this can provide a more predictable income stream, it may also come with additional administrative responsibilities and limitations on the services you can provide.

Understanding the Cost of Dental Care in Singapore

Dental treatments in Singapore can range from basic procedures such as fillings and cleanings to more complex treatments like dental implants and orthodontic procedures. The cost of these treatments can vary significantly depending on the complexity and the materials used.

For example, a simple dental filling can cost around SGD 100 to SGD 200, while more extensive procedures like dental implants can range from SGD 3,000 to SGD 6,000 per tooth. Orthodontic treatments such as braces or aligners can cost anywhere from SGD 3,000 to SGD 10,000 or more, depending on the complexity of the case.

It is important to keep in mind that these are just rough estimates, and the actual cost may vary depending on various factors. It is always recommended to consult with a dental professional to get an accurate assessment and cost estimate for your specific dental needs.

The Hidden Secrets of Alaska Cruise Whale Sightings

While the chance to see whales is one of the main draws of an Alaska cruise, there are a few hidden secrets that can enhance your chances of a memorable sighting.

One of the best-kept secrets is to keep an eye out for flocks of seabirds. Birds such as gulls, terns, and kittiwakes often gather above the water where whales are feeding. If you spot a large group of birds circling and diving, chances are there's a whale nearby.

Another secret is to listen for the distinctive sound of a whale's blow. When a whale surfaces to breathe, it exhales forcefully, creating a spout of water and air. This sound can often be heard from a distance, alerting you to the presence of a whale.

Loan Terms

When you take out a college loan, you borrow a certain amount of money to cover your educational expenses. This borrowed amount is subject to interest, which is the cost of borrowing the money. Interest rates can vary depending on the type of loan and whether it is subsidized or unsubsidized. Subsidized loans do not accrue interest while you are in school, while unsubsidized loans start accruing interest immediately.

Repayment Options

Repayment of college loans typically begins after you graduate, leave school, or drop below half-time enrollment. It is important to carefully review the repayment options available to you, as they can have a significant impact on your financial future. Some common repayment plans include standard repayment, income-based repayment, and graduated repayment.

Fun Facts About College Loans

Did you know that the first federal student loan program was established in 1958? It was called the National Defense Education Act and provided loans to students pursuing degrees in science, math, and engineering. Over the years, the availability and accessibility of college loans have increased, with more options for students to finance their education.

Question and Answer

Q: Can I get a college loan if I have bad credit?

A: It depends on the type of loan. Federal loans do not require a credit check, so bad credit does not necessarily disqualify you. Private loans, on the other hand, may require a cosigner or have stricter credit requirements.

Q: How long do I have to repay my college loans?

A: The repayment period for college loans varies depending on the type of loan and the repayment plan you choose. It can range from 10 to 30 years.

Q: Can I refinance my college loans?

A: Yes, refinancing your college loans allows you to replace your current loans with a new loan that has better terms, such as a lower interest rate. However, it is important to carefully consider the pros and cons before refinancing.
